
MyBatis
文章平均质量分 75
ryelqy
我要将代码写到我看不到屏幕那一天为止^_^
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
MyBatis插入语句返回主键值
当需要用到中间表处理数据时,需要用到新插入语句的主键Id值,这时候可以通过设置MyBatis来获取返回值:MyBatis默认不回填Id值,为false值。 insert into t_blog values(null,#{title},#{content});其中:userGenerateKeys为true,则在插入后,回填Id值。keyProperty设置主键名称。原创 2017-06-21 18:19:09 · 555 阅读 · 1 评论 -
Mybatis 中$与#的区别
1 #是将传入的值当做字符串的形式,eg:select id,name,age from student where id =#{id},当前端把id值1,传入到后台的时候,就相当于 select id,name,age from student where id ='1'. 2 $是将传入的数据直接显示生成sql语句,eg:select id,name,age from student转载 2017-10-10 14:56:16 · 806 阅读 · 0 评论 -
SpringBoot整合MyBatis例子
1、pom.xml <?xml version="1.0" encoding="UTF-8"?><project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://mav原创 2017-11-06 21:43:10 · 2573 阅读 · 0 评论 -
MyBatis3-基于注解的示例
在基于注解的示例中,可以简化编写XML的过程,全部采用注解方式进行编写,并在注解上写SQL语句,语句和XML的语句保持一致,并且可以省略掉XML文件不用引入的好处。但还有一点,基于注解的方式还没有百分百覆盖所有XML标签,所有还是有一点缺陷。在org.apache.ibatis.annotations包下包含了所有注解。下面引用官方文档的说明http://www.mybatis.org/mybat...转载 2018-06-14 09:37:55 · 2438 阅读 · 0 评论 -
MyBatis传入参数为list、数组、map写法
1.foreach简单介绍:foreach的主要用在构建in条件中,它可以在SQL语句中进行迭代一个集合。foreach元素的属性主要有item,index,collection,open,separator,close。item表示集合中每一个元素进行迭代时的别名,index指定一个名字,用于表示在迭代过程中,每次迭代到的位置,open表示该语句以什么开始,separator表示在每次进行迭代之...转载 2018-06-14 19:05:51 · 421 阅读 · 0 评论